Output 56d6dbe222406291ba01a7408303d68d0dc170c0c97b252137de215c63400f86:9

value
348380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238727bd8a22ccdae1630a4edd093905bae5bd85 OP_EQUAL
address
34vsV1RyFvKPuVzA7ehShg5ANcYfN1Jok7
transaction
56d6dbe222406291ba01a7408303d68d0dc170c0c97b252137de215c63400f86
confirmations
238298
spent
true